SSPISGCON is a standard SAP Table which is used to store SPI: Signature Condition Records data and is available within R/3 SAP systems depending on the version and release level.

The SSPISGCON table consists of various fields, each holding specific information or linking keys about SPI: Signature Condition Records data available in SAP. These include SIGNATURE (Global SPI: Agent Signature), AGENTID (SPI Global: Agent ID), FLDNAME (SPI: Data Field Name), FLDCNT (SPI: Counter (0-255)).. Delivery Class: E - Control table, SAP and customer have separate key areas
Display/Maintenance via tcode SM30: Display/Maintenance Allowed but with Restrictions
SAP enhancement categories: Cannot Be Enhanced

How do I retrieve data from SAP table SSPISGCON using ABAP code

The following ABAP code Example will allow you to do a basic selection on SSPISGCON to SELECT all data from the table
DATA: WA_SSPISGCON TYPE SSPISGCON.

SELECT SINGLE *
FROM SSPISGCON
INTO CORRESPONDING FIELDS OF WA_SSPISGCON
WHERE...

How to access SAP table SSPISGCON

Within an ECC or HANA version of SAP you can also view further information about SSPISGCON and the data within it using relevant transactions such as

SE11 (ABAP Dictionary Maintenance)
SM30 (Maintain Table Data)
SE80 (Object Navigator)
SE16 (Data Browser).
